Recently the LHCb collaboration observed five new narrow excited states in the $\bar{K}\Xi_c$ invariant mass spectrum: the $\Omega_c(3000)$, $\Omega_c(3050)$,$\Omega_c(3065)$, $\Omega_c(3090)$ and $\Omega_c(3119)$. We systematically investigate the spectrum and decay properties of charm-strange mesons using a chiral unitary approach that combines Weinberg-Tomozawa interactions with bare $c\bar{s}$ states from the constituent quark model.
